Meaning of make conscience | Babel Free

Verb CEFR B2

Definitions

To make it a matter of conscience; to be scrupulous about.

obsolete

Examples

“I make a conscience [translating faits conscience], standing neare some great person, if mine eyes chance, at unwares, to steale some knowledge of any letters of importance that he readeth.”
“I mention this story also as the best method I can advise any person to take in such a case, especially if he be one that makes conscience of his duty, and would be directed what to do in it[…].”
“The pursy man means by freedom the right to do as he pleases, and does wrong in order to feel his freedom, and makes a conscience of persisting in it.”
